Investigating The Expression Changes of miR-93-3p, NFATc1 and NFATc3 Genes in Peripheral Blood Mononuclear Cells (PBMC) of Breast Cancer Patients

Background & Objectives: Breast cancer is the most lethal malignancy in women. miRNAs function as epigenetic regulators and contribute to the pathogenesis of breast cancer.
